76+ ### Vue
77+
78+ If you're using Vue and Inertia, install Apexcharts and their Vue 3 adapter:
79+
80+ ``` bash
81+ npm install --save apexcharts
82+ npm install --save vue3-apexcharts
83+ ```
84+
85+ ``` js
86+ // resources/js/app.js
87+
88+ import VueApexCharts from ' vue3-apexcharts' ;
89+
90+ createInertiaApp ({
91+ // ...
92+ setup ({el, App, props, plugin}) {
93+ return createApp ({ render : () => h (App, props) })
94+ .use (VueApexCharts)
95+ .mount (el);
96+ },
97+ });
98+ ```
99+
100+ Then, create a simple ` chart.vue ` component:
101+
102+ ``` vue
103+ <!-- components/chart.vue -->
104+
105+ <template>
106+ <apexchart
107+ :type="chart.type"
108+ :width="chart.width"
109+ :height="chart.height"
110+ :series="chart.series"
111+ :options="chart.options"
112+ />
113+ </template>
114+
115+ <script setup>
116+ defineProps({
117+ chart: Object,
118+ });
119+ </script>
120+ ```
121+
122+ Create an instance of ` Chart ` and call ` toVue() ` before passing it to your page:
123+
124+ ``` php
125+ Route::get('dashboard', function () {
126+ $chart = (new Chart)->setType('...');
127+
128+ return inertia('dashboard', [
129+ 'chart' => $chart->toVue(),
130+ ]);
131+ });
132+ ```
133+
134+ Finally, render the chart:
135+
136+ ``` vue
137+ <!-- pages/dashboard.vue -->
138+
139+ <template>
140+ <Chart :chart="chart" />
141+ </template>
142+
143+ <script setup>
144+ import Chart from './components/chart.vue';
145+
146+ defineProps({
147+ chart: Object,
148+ });
149+ </script>
150+ ```
